LADY GALWAY
TROUT FISHING .HOLIDAY. Pei Press Association —Copyright) TAUPO, March 9. Lady Galway, who.is spending a fishing holiday, accompanied by Captain Stuart French, A.D.C., at the Fulljames Camp, enjoyed a good clay’s sport yesterday on the lake. Fly fishing at the mouth of the Waihoro Stream, Her Excellency landed eight .fish, including one of 7Jlb. Earl Ranfurly, also of the party, landed his limit, the best being 81b. Captain Stuart French secured 10 fish, the beet'weighing 6Jib;
